Payments to structural fund beneficiaries hit 1.2bn euros
Of the 8.6bn euros in European structural funds available for
the 2007-2010 period, local authorities have so far transferred
1.2bn euros to beneficiaries, meaning a 13.4% absorption rate.
Major payments have started being operated over the past two
months, when those who won European projected received almost 260m
euros.
The programme that made the biggest headway is the one destined to
human resources development (POSDRU), which last year lagged behind
the others in terms of European money absorption.
POSDRU has 1.5bn euros allotted during the 2007-2010 period, and
payments so far have amounted to 300m euros. authorities say the
progress is because of the fact that those winning European fund
projects get a 30% pre-financing in the eligible value of the
project.
The lowest absorption rate is still registered by the operational
transport programme, at 1.85%, which operated 37m-euro payments of
a total of 2bn euros earmarked for it in 2007-2010.
